Can a round air stone diffuser be used in an aquarium?
2025-01-09 08:54:06
Yes, a round air stone diffuser can absolutely be used in an aquarium. These versatile devices are excellent for improving water circulation and oxygenation in fish tanks of various sizes. Round air stone diffusers create a steady stream of fine bubbles that not only enhance oxygen levels but also contribute to a visually appealing aquatic environment. Their circular shape allows for even distribution of air throughout the tank, making them particularly effective in promoting healthy water conditions. While there are many types of aquarium aerators available, round air stone diffusers remain a popular choice due to their efficiency, ease of use, and aesthetic appeal. When properly maintained, these diffusers can significantly benefit the overall health and well-being of your aquatic ecosystem.
Benefits of Using Round Air Stone Diffusers in Aquariums
Enhanced Oxygenation for Aquatic Life
Round air stone diffusers play a crucial role in maintaining optimal oxygen levels in aquariums. As these devices release a multitude of tiny bubbles, they increase the water's surface area exposed to air, facilitating efficient gas exchange. This process ensures that dissolved oxygen is readily available for fish, plants, and beneficial bacteria. Adequate oxygenation is vital for the respiratory health of aquatic creatures and supports essential biological processes within the tank ecosystem.
Improved Water Circulation
The gentle yet consistent flow of bubbles produced by round air stone diffusers creates water movement throughout the aquarium. This circulation helps prevent stagnant areas where debris and harmful substances might accumulate. By promoting water movement, these diffusers contribute to more uniform temperature distribution and aid in the dispersal of nutrients. This improved circulation is particularly beneficial in tanks with delicate plant life or species that prefer gentle water flow.

Choosing the Right Round Air Stone Diffuser for Your Aquarium
Size Considerations
Selecting the appropriate size of round air stone diffuser is crucial for optimal performance in your aquarium. The size should be proportional to your tank's volume to ensure effective oxygenation and circulation. For smaller tanks up to 20 gallons, a 2-inch diameter diffuser may suffice. Medium-sized aquariums between 20-50 gallons might benefit from a 3-4 inch diffuser, while larger tanks over 50 gallons may require multiple diffusers or larger models of 5 inches or more in diameter. It's important to note that overlarge diffusers in small tanks can create excessive turbulence, potentially stressing some fish species.
Material Quality
The material composition of your round air stone diffuser significantly impacts its performance and longevity. High-quality ceramic or silica-based diffusers are known for their durability and ability to produce fine, uniform bubbles. These materials resist clogging and maintain consistent performance over time. Some modern diffusers incorporate composite materials that combine the benefits of traditional stones with advanced polymer technology, offering improved bubble production and longevity. When choosing a diffuser, opt for reputable brands that use food-grade, non-toxic materials to ensure the safety of your aquatic inhabitants.
Bubble Size and Distribution
The effectiveness of a round air stone diffuser largely depends on the size and distribution of the bubbles it produces. Ideally, you want a diffuser that creates a fine mist of tiny bubbles rather than large, rapid bubbles. Smaller bubbles have a larger surface area-to-volume ratio, which enhances gas exchange efficiency. Look for diffusers that promise micro-bubble production, as these are most effective for oxygenation. Additionally, consider the bubble distribution pattern. A well-designed round diffuser should provide even coverage across its entire surface, ensuring uniform oxygenation and circulation throughout the tank.
Maintenance and Troubleshooting of Round Air Stone Diffusers
Regular Cleaning Procedures
Maintaining your round air stone diffuser is essential for its continued efficiency. Over time, algae, mineral deposits, and debris can accumulate on the surface, reducing its effectiveness. To clean, gently remove the diffuser from the tank and soak it in a solution of equal parts water and white vinegar for several hours. This helps dissolve mineral buildup. For stubborn deposits, use a soft brush to gently scrub the surface, being careful not to damage the porous material. Rinse thoroughly with clean water before returning the diffuser to the aquarium. Regular cleaning, typically every 1-2 months, can significantly extend the life of your diffuser and maintain its performance.
Addressing Common Issues
Even with proper maintenance, round air stone diffusers may encounter issues. A common problem is reduced bubble production, which can be caused by clogging or a weakening air pump. If you notice a decrease in bubble output, first check the air pump and tubing for any kinks or blockages. Ensure all connections are secure and free from air leaks. If the problem persists, the diffuser itself may be clogged internally. In such cases, a more thorough cleaning or replacement may be necessary. Some aquarists find success in boiling heavily clogged diffusers for a few minutes to clear internal blockages, though this should be done cautiously as it may affect the integrity of some materials.
Longevity and Replacement
The lifespan of a round air stone diffuser can vary greatly depending on its quality, usage, and maintenance. With proper care, a high-quality diffuser can last anywhere from 6 months to 2 years. However, it's important to monitor its performance regularly. Signs that it's time to replace your diffuser include persistent reduction in bubble production despite cleaning, visible cracks or damage to the surface, or a significant change in the size or distribution of bubbles. When replacing, consider upgrading to a more durable or efficient model if you've been experiencing frequent issues. Remember, a well-functioning diffuser is crucial for maintaining a healthy aquarium environment, so don't hesitate to replace it when necessary.
